Abstract

An image processor comprises an image pre-processing block and an encoder processing block for processing and encoding an image. The image pre-processing block receives image data and processes it to provide an image comprising image sections which each comprise pixels. For each of the image sections, the pixels are analyzed to estimate an indication of the complexity of the image section, and metadata is determined based on the estimated complexity indications of the image sections. The metadata is passed to the encoder processing block which uses it to determine a quantization level for use in encoding the image. The encoder processing block can then encode the image using the determined quantization level. Conveniently, the image pre-processing block 106 processes the image data to provide the image, and therefore has access to the image which it can analyze to determine the metadata without requiring a separate read operation of the image.
